Our process

Our water damage mold cleanup process in Kirkwood, MO

Inspect

We map moisture with meters and thermal imaging to find every wet cavity, not just the visible stain.

Contain

Plastic sheeting and negative air pressure keep spores from spreading to dry rooms while we work.

Remove

Saturated drywall, insulation, and trim that can't be dried are cut out and bagged for disposal.

Dry

Commercial air movers and dehumidifiers bring the structure back to a normal moisture range.

Verify

Final moisture readings confirm the space is dry before we close out the job.

What it costs

Water Damage Mold Cleanup cost in Kirkwood, MO

Every job is different, so here are the typical Missouri ranges we see. These are planning numbers, not a quote.

Small area
$500 to $1,500

A single moldy spot, a closet, or under a sink. We contain it, remove it, and treat the surface.

One room
$1,500 to $3,500

A bathroom, kitchen, or bedroom with mold on a wall or ceiling, plus the moisture source fixed.

Basement, attic, or crawl space
$2,000 to $6,000

Larger areas that need more containment and drying. Common here after spring rain or a slow leak.

Whole-house or severe
$10,000 and up

Mold across several rooms or after major water damage. We work in phases, room by room.

Water Damage Mold Cleanup in Kirkwood, MO: common questions

How soon can mold grow after water damage?

Under the right conditions mold can begin growing within 24 to 48 hours of a surface staying wet, which is why fast drying matters as much as the cleanup itself.

Will insurance cover water damage mold cleanup?

Coverage depends on your policy and the cause of the water intrusion. We document the damage thoroughly and can work directly with your carrier.

Can I just dry it out myself with fans?

Fans can help with surface moisture, but they usually can't dry a wet wall cavity or subfloor completely, and mold can start before it's fully dry.

Do you handle both the drying and the mold removal?

Yes, our crew handles moisture mapping, structural drying, and mold removal as one coordinated job instead of separate visits.

What if the water damage happened weeks ago?

Older water damage often means mold has already started behind walls or under flooring. We inspect thoroughly since the visible damage rarely matches what's hidden inside the cavity.
